The Galaxy Book2 has a general score of 81.9, which is a little bit better than the Galaxy Tab A 10.5's 74.5 score. Galaxy Book2 comes with Windows 10 S operating system, while Galaxy Tab A 10.5 comes with Android 9.0 Pie operating system. The Galaxy Book2 design is a little bit thinner but incredibly heavier than the Galaxy Tab A 10.5, and they were only released 2 months apart.
The Samsung Galaxy Book2 counts with a little better processing power than Galaxy Tab A 10.5, because although it has a lower number of cores , it also counts with 1 GB more RAM memory. Samsung Galaxy Book2 features just a bit better display than Samsung Galaxy Tab A 10.5, and although they both have the same display density, the Samsung Galaxy Book2 also has a bit larger display and a bit higher 2160 x 1440 pixels resolution.
Galaxy Book2 features a much better storage for games and applications than Samsung Galaxy Tab A 10.5, because it has more internal storage and a SD card slot that allows a maximum of 512 GB. The Galaxy Tab A 10.5 counts with greater battery duration than Galaxy Book2, because it has 7300mAh of battery capacity.
Galaxy Book2 captures just a bit better pictures and videos than Galaxy Tab A 10.5, and although they both have a same size camera sensor, a F1.9 aperture and the same resolution back-facing camera, the Galaxy Book2 also has a much higher 3840x2160 video quality.
Although Galaxy Book2 is a better device, it costs a lot more than the Galaxy Tab A 10.5, and it doesn't have such a good relation between it's price and quality as Galaxy Tab A 10.5. If you want to save a few dollars, you can get the Galaxy Tab A 10.5, and give up a couple features and specs, but you will get the most out of your money.
